Canada’s Indigenous contracting program funnels billions to Ottawa-area firms 11/04/2025

Billions of dollars in federal contracts intended to support Indigenous businesses across Canada are being awarded to two dozen firms in Ottawa, leaving many regions out in the cold.

Canada’s Indigenous contracting program funnels billions to Ottawa-area firms Businesses in western provinces with large Indigenous populations largely shut out

Corporate lobbying heats up around governments’ nuclear power plans despite concerns from anti-nuclear advocates 06/05/2024

Canada has seen rising support for nuclear power development.

Anti-nuclear advocates blame this trend on “very, very powerful” lobbying by the nuclear industry.

Corporate lobbying heats up around governments’ nuclear power plans despite concerns from anti-nuclear advocates Critics say nuclear too costly and slow to build while supporters back it as a climate solution
